The recent Founders’ Exchange event at Galway’s PorterShed shed light on the diverse realities of the start-up world. Founders emphasized that in this dynamic landscape, one size does not fit all. This insight resonates deeply with the intricate challenges faced by entrepreneurs in today’s competitive market.

At the event, seasoned founders shared valuable experiences and perspectives, highlighting the importance of tailored approaches in navigating the start-up ecosystem. This personalized strategy is crucial for addressing the unique needs of each venture, considering factors such as market dynamics, target audience, and competitive positioning.

In the fast-paced realm of start-ups, a cookie-cutter approach rarely leads to success. By acknowledging the individuality of each business and embracing customized solutions, founders can effectively adapt to changing circumstances and carve out their niche in the market.

For instance, a SaaS start-up targeting enterprise clients may require a different go-to-market strategy compared to a consumer-focused e-commerce platform. Understanding these nuances and aligning strategies accordingly can significantly impact the trajectory of a start-up’s growth and sustainability.
